FACILITATING COMMUNICATION WITH A VEHICLE VIA A UAV

    Abstract: Embodiments are provided for facilitating communications with a vehicle through an unmanned aerial vehicle (UAV). The UAV can be configured to track vehicles traveling in an area covered by the UAV. An identification of the vehicle can be acquired after the vehicle is tracked by the UAV. The vehicle identification can be used to determine communication capability of the vehicle. Based on the determined communication capability of the vehicle, a communication request can be initiated by the UAV. The vehicle can determine either accept the communication request from the UAV or turn it down. If the vehicle accepts the communication request from the UAV, information intended for the vehicle, for example from another vehicle, can be forwarded to the vehicle by the UAV.

    Abstract: Embodiments are provided for deliver information to a transportation apparatus via a UAV network. After the transportation apparatus enters an area, one or more UAVs may be configured to capture one or more images of an interior of the transportation apparatus. Information regarding the transportation apparatus can be collected by the UAV(s), such as the make and multimedia presentation capability of the transportation apparatus, in response to the images being received. Image analysis may be employed to analyze the images to obtain passenger and/or driver information. Based on the information regard the transportation apparatus, and passenger and/or driver information, one or more items can be determined for presentation to the passenger(s) and/or driver(s) in the transportation apparatus. The one or more items may include local information of interest to the passenger(s) and driver(s). The one or more items can be transmitted to transportation apparatus for presentation.

    Abstract: The present invention relates to a read-once record medium, comprising: a data substrate, having control data zone and a data zone, and said having pre-record data; a sensitive layer, disposed above said data substrate; a refractive layer, disposed above said sensitive layer; an adhesive layer, disposed above said refractive layer; and a transparent substrate, disposed above said adhesive layer; thereby, the structure of said sensitive layer or said data substrate will be changed when laser beams with specified power emitted from an optical storage device pass through the data substrate and focus on the sensitive layer, and the laser beams will be reflected by the sensitive layer and can not be recognized by the optical storage device. Furthermore, the present invention also provides a system with read protecting function.

    Abstract: The present invention relates to a system with read protecting function that comprises a record medium, having a data substrate with a control data zone and a data zone thereon, wherein the control data zone has a plurality of blocks, and every block has a plurality of sectors, and every sector has a plurality of bytes, and the data zone has encoded data, as well as a control code is disposed in the one of the sectors in control data zone; an optical storage device, for loading the record medium and reading and identifying the control code, then decoding the control code and outputs the decoded data if the control code is identifiable; or directly output the encoded data if the control code is not identifiable. Furthermore, the present invention relates to a method for protecting a record medium.

    Abstract: Systems and methods for automatically parking and wirelessly charging a vehicle are described. A database including parking and charging availability information can be searched based at least in part on the request, location information and model information of the vehicle. An available parking space is determined based on the results of the search, and information. The parking space may be equipped with a pad configured to wireless charge a vehicle parked in the parking space. When information indicating that the vehicle has been parked in the parking space, a parking status indicating such can be transmitted to a control device associated with the parking space. The vehicle can then be automatically and wirelessly charged by the control device through the parking space.

    Abstract: Embodiments are provided for facilitating a wide-view video conference through a UAV network. For facilitating the wide-view video conference, UAVs can be employed to capture and transmit video data at locations of parties involved in the wide-view video conference. One or more UAVs in the UAV network can be instructed to locate the party's location and zoom-in onto the party's location. In some examples, the UAV(s) can be equipped with a 360 degree video camera such that a wide-area covered by the 360 degree video can be captured. The video data can be transmitted to a video data processing center in real-time or substantially in real-time. The video data transmission by the given UAV to the video data processing center can be through a UAV network. The video stream can be output at a location of a given party in the video conference.

    Abstract: Embodiments facilitate charging of electric vehicles (EVs) in an EV charging network. The EV charging network can include an EV charging server in communication with a power grid and with a number of geographically distributed EV charging stations electrically coupled with the power grid, receiving station capacity information and grid capacity information therefrom, respectively. In response to receiving an EV charging request, the EV charging server can: compute a charging timeframe; identify one or more EV charging stations as available for charging the requesting EV during the charging timeframe as a function of the station capacity information, and as having at least a threshold associated power delivery capacity for charging the requesting EV during the charging timeframe as a function of the grid capacity information; and communicate an EV charging response via the communication network to direct the requesting EV to the identified EV charging station(s).

    Abstract: Embodiments provide a system to detect abnormal breathing by a person, such as a baby, through a piece of clothing worn by the person. The piece of clothing may be adapted to include a sound sensor that can collect breathing sounds by the person. The piece of clothing may also be adapted to include an inflatable neck support that can be automatically inflated without the person's intervention. The breathing sound signals by the person can be processed for determining whether the person breathing abnormally. When it is determined that the person is breathing abnormally, an instruction to inflate the inflatable neck support of the clothing may be generated. Such an instruction can be transmitted to the clothing wirelessly to effectuate the inflation of the inflatable neck support so the person's incorrect breathing posture that causes the abnormal breathing can be addressed.

    Abstract: Provided are systems and methods for increasing vehicle safety by determining whether a driver can operate a vehicle based on whether the physical status of the driver and the identity of the driver are acceptable. A first set of sensors may determine the physical status of the driver. The first set of sensors may include an electrocardiogram detection component, an alcohol detection component, a body temperature detection component, and a photography component, among others. A second set of sensors may determine the identity of the driver. The second set of sensors may a fingerprint detection component, an electrocardiogram detection component, and a photography component, among others. When it is determined that the physical status of the driver is unacceptable, the method may include activating an automatic driving system.
